What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a ScaleOps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a ScaleOps Engineer, you need expertise in scalable systems design, cloud infrastructure, and automation, typically supported by a degree in computer science or related field. Familiarity with tools like Kubernetes, Docker, Terraform, and cloud platforms (AWS, GCP, or Azure) is essential, along with relevant certifications such as AWS Certified Solutions Architect. Strong problem-solving, collaboration, and communication skills help in working across teams to ensure system reliability and rapid incident response. These skills are crucial for maintaining efficient, resilient, and scalable infrastructure that supports business growth and minimizes downtime.

What are the typical challenges faced by a ScaleOps professional when managing large-scale infrastructure automation?

ScaleOps professionals often encounter challenges related to automating and orchestrating infrastructure in rapidly growing environments. These can include maintaining system reliability during scaling, managing configuration drift, integrating new tools into existing workflows, and ensuring security compliance. Effective collaboration with development, security, and operations teams is crucial to anticipate scaling needs and address incidents quickly. The fast-paced nature of ScaleOps roles also demands continual learning and adaptation to new technologies and best practices.
